Summary

Glynn H. Brock Elementary School in Slidell, LA, serves 345 students in grades PK-5 and is part of the highly-rated St. Tammany Parish school district, though the school itself faces significant challenges related to a high-poverty population, with nearly 79% of students qualifying for free or reduced lunch.

The most defining issue at Brock Elementary is its critically high chronic absenteeism rate of 31.7% for the 2024-2025 school year, which is nearly 50% higher than the district and state averages and significantly exceeds rates at nearby schools like Alton Elementary School (22.9%) and Bonne Ecole Elementary School (19.9%). This absenteeism is a primary driver of academic struggles, especially in math, where proficiency has dropped sharply from 61% in 2022-2023 to just 39% in 2025-2026—a 32-point gap behind the district average. In contrast, the school shows a clear strength in English Language Arts (ELA), with 68% of students proficient, close to the state average of 70% and consistent across grades 3 through 5, suggesting effective literacy instruction that partially overcomes the barriers of poverty and absenteeism.

Compared to other high-poverty schools in the area, such as Florida Avenue Elementary School and W.L. Abney Elementary, Brock's overall state ranking (39th percentile) is similar, but its math proficiency is notably lower than W.L. Abney's 43%, indicating that factors beyond poverty—particularly absenteeism—are compounding challenges. The school's inconsistent performance across student groups, such as a steep decline for female students, suggests targeted interventions may be needed. Reducing absenteeism to the district average could have a transformative effect on all test scores, especially in math and social studies, where sequential learning is most impacted by missed instruction.
